Story | The Prosecco DOC territory extends across the flat areas of Treviso, a wine produced mainly from Glera grapes. The wide expanses of rows in the plains favour mainly machine processing and harvesting. |
Climate | Altitude: 100 m. a.s.l. |
Soil composition | Clayey soil. |
Cultivation system | Double inversion. |
Yield per hectare | 180 q. |
Harvest | End of September. |
Wine making | Primary fermentation: static decanting of the must and fermentation with selected yeasts at a controlled temperature (18 9°C). Left on the fine lees for at least 3 months. |
Aging | Secondary fermentation: refermentation in large containers for at least 30-40 days. |
